Abstract

. In modern conditions of Russia, the implementation of federal projects of the national program «Digital Economy of the Russian Federation» has become particularly relevant. The scientific community pays special attention to the discussion of the modern concept of the «digital economy» and the practice of the development of regional digitalization processes. The paper provides a critical analysis of foreign and domestic approaches to the problem of digitalization of agriculture in Russia. The authors have proposed an approach to implementing the digitalization strategy of the constituent entities of the Russian Federation in the framework of federal projects of the national program «Digital Economy of the Russian Federation».
